Parcells doesn't want the teams practices vied on television. He is afraid that other teams can scout them by watching the news coverage. It is not like his schemes have really changed. Run the ball as much as you can, then use play action passes set up by the run and then try a trick play once a game after passing the 50 yard line. He is a paranoid guy, but that is the way he wants it.
